3-Amino-N-ethylbenzamide
3-Amino-N-ethylbenzamide (CAS: 81882-77-1), with the molecular formula C9H12N2O and a molecular weight of 164.20 g/mol, is an organic compound classified as an amide and amine. This versatile molecule serves as a valuable building block in organic synthesis. It is primarily utilised in chemical research and development, facilitating the construction of more complex molecular structures for various scientific investigations.
